Sump Pump Installation in West Des Moines, IA
Sump pump installation services involve setting up a device designed to remove excess water from a basement or crawl space, helping to prevent flooding and water damage. These systems are typically installed in areas prone to heavy rainfall or where groundwater levels are high, providing reliable protection during storms or heavy precipitation. Projects can range from installing a new sump pump in a finished basement to upgrading an existing system for improved performance, ensuring property owners maintain a dry and secure foundation.
Before requesting sump pump installation, property owners usually want to understand the specific needs of their property, such as the size of the area that requires protection and the level of water flow expected during heavy rain. It’s also important to consider the type of sump pump suitable for the space, whether a pedestal or submersible model, and any additional components needed for proper drainage and venting. Clarifying these details can help ensure the system is effective and tailored to the property’s unique requirements.

Sump Pump Installation Questions
What is a sump pump? A sump pump is a device installed in basements or crawl spaces to remove excess water and prevent flooding.
Why should homeowners consider sump pump installation? It helps protect property from water damage caused by he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
Where is a sump pump typically installed? It is usually placed in a sump basin or pit located in the lowest part of the basement or crawl space.
What types of sump pumps are available? Common options include pedestal and submersible pumps, each suited for different needs and spaces.
